Charles H. Conners

February 19, 1945 - August 10, 2024

Charles H. Conners was surrounded by his wife, Sandra; children, Lori, Carrie, and Timothy; and granddaughters, Madelynn, Abby and Elizabeth Baker, at the time of his passing on Saturday, August 10, 2024. He was born on February 19, 1945, in Port Arthur, to Ruby Lee Cousins Conners and Pierre Charles Conners.

Charles was raised and attended school in Buna. After high school, he served in the United States Navy for a short time before he became an Oil/Gas Refinery Maintenance Specialist and Millwright.  He began his career at the Goodyear plant in Beaumont.  His career carried him to jobs overseas with Aramco in Ras Tanura, Saudi Arabia and with Exxon in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

He was a friendly, happy, and generous person whose personality will be sorely missed.

Survivors include his wife, Sandra Conners; children, Lori Conners, Carrie Conners, and Timothy Conners; grandchildren, Madelynn Baker, Abby Baker, and Elizabeth Baker; and siblings, Ruby Timlin, Patsy Dillon, Mary Penquerne, and Donald Conners; and nieces and nephews who live in the area.  He is preceded in death by his parents; sister, Desiree Conners; and brother, Joe Conners
